**Finance Review — Second-Source Hunt**

Short version for department heads: the search for a backup supplier on the Torbine gear sets is going okay, not great. Two candidates cleared commercial checks; one wants a minimum volume we can't promise yet. We've ring-fenced a modest budget for qualification runs through Q2, so don't be surprised by the line item. Greta owns the file while Sunil is out. The confidential note on where this feeds our wider plans sits just below.

management briefing: Silethax Systems plans to raise the Holix list price by 50.2 percent in December. The steering committee signed off on a budget of $329.9 million for Project Holok. The renewal with Juldorax Foods closes at $278.2 million a year, 54.3 percent above the last contract. Project Briir slips by one quarter because of the supplier delay.

# Break-Glass: Catalog Cache Invalidation

Scope: the Pinrow product catalog at Veldstone Retail. If stale prices persist after a purge and the Hollowmere invalidation queue is wedged, use break-glass to flush the edge tier directly. Contractors: get verbal sign-off from the catalog lead first. Steps: open the Hollowmere admin shell, select emergency-flush, confirm the tenant, and run it once — repeated flushes thrash the origin. Access is logged and expires after 20 minutes. Unseal the admin shell with the passphrase below.

recovery phrase for kahop-tajog: istix-casvan

- [ ] Step 7: Archive cold storage buckets (Glacierline tier). Confirm both ceremony witnesses are present, verify bucket manifests match the Oxbow ledger, then seal the archive key shares. Plugin authors may observe but not handle shares. Once sealed, the archive index itself is encrypted and can only be reopened with the passphrase below.

vault phrase of badup-hahig = tamael-aldael-kelmir-istael-fenok-istwyn-tamius-jorath-oliion

FeeForge release, step 6. After the shipping-fee rules engine passes the Marbury regression suite, build the rules bundle with `make bundle`. Bundle version must match the tariff table revision in config/tariffs.yml or downstream Cartwheel nodes will reject it. Push to the staging registry only; prod promotion happens via the Ostlin pipeline after sign-off. The registry rejects unsigned bundles outright, so sign before pushing. Sign the bundle with the deploy key below.

rollout seal: bky4_DFM9